Guy. You might be just as well off buying a laser pointer from Jaycar or Dick Smith or the like. (Do they still use them for pointing at overheads in training sessions?) I held them switched on with a bit of tape over the button and mounted them with plasticine to align my drivetrain and some body panels... Worked a treat and cheap as chips.

I think Mike's has a grooved base specific for pulley alignment.
